WABCO Announces Multi-Year Contract with IVECO to Supply Anti-Lock Braking Technology for Light- and Medium-Duty Trucks in South America
BRUSSELS, BELGIUM--(Marketwire - May 15, 2012) - WABCO Holdings Inc. (NYSE:WBC), ([ www.wabco-auto.com ]) a global technology leader and tier-one supplier to the commercial vehicle industry, has entered into a long term agreement with IVECO to supply anti-lock braking technology for IVECO's platforms of light- and medium-duty trucks produced in Brazil from 2013 onward. IVECO, a global manufacturer of commercial vehicles, is headquartered in Turin, Italy.
WABCO's new agreement with IVECO is consistent with the Brazilian federal government's mandate for compulsory anti-lock braking systems (ABS) on new trucks, buses and trailers to further increase vehicle and road safety. According to Brazilian legislation, 40 percent of total commercial vehicles produced in Brazil in 2013 must be equipped with ABS and 100 percent in 2014.
Presently, a small percentage of new commercial vehicles registered in Brazil are equipped with ABS which prevents locking of a vehicle's wheels when road friction is not sufficient to transmit braking forces. WABCO pioneered ABS for commercial vehicles in 1981 and is by far the local market's leading technology supplier.

WABCO has a long established supply relationship with IVECO globally. WABCO furnishes anti-lock braking, electronic braking and electronically controlled air suspension systems, as well as air compressor technology, vehicle control modules and braking products, among other vehicle components.
About WABCO
WABCO (NYSE:WBC) is a leading global supplier of technologies and control systems for the safety and efficiency of commercial vehicles. For over 140 years, WABCO has pioneered breakthrough electronic, mechanical and mechatronic technologies for braking, stability and transmission automation systems supplied to the world's leading commercial truck, trailer and bus manufacturers. With sales of $2.8 billion in 2011, WABCO is headquartered in Brussels, Belgium. For more information, visit [ www.wabco-auto.com ].
